About: I have had dogs since childhood, and I love the companionship they provide. I would love to bond with your pets and care for them like my own! I have previously lived with my sister & her rescue pit bull, who had many allergies/recurring ear infections. That experience taught me how important maintaining a strict diet and clean ears is. I've had a Mastiff who also would get frequent ear infections, along with hematomas, due to the scratching/flapping that accompanied the ear infections. My first pet in my teens was named Clyde. A pit bull/chow mix who was attached to my hip and I loved sooo dearly. Clyde was my first baby, and I still think about him very often. I've had many other pets throughout my life, so I could type forever! I am a full-time nursing student with availability on evenings/nights/weekends. I prefer longer house-sitting stays as it is easier to build a routine with pets and completely integrate them into my life during the visit. However, I am not limited to more extended stays, so please message me even if it’s for a couple of days! I am currently living with a fellow classmate, and she also is a Rover sitter. We have two small dogs with us who are so loving and well behaved. I prefer to only board dogs under 10 pounds. I have been at a new job, and I have had a few 12-hour days (0700-1900). However, I have only been working about one day a week, and currently have a 12 hour clinical on Fridays. To best care for your pets, let's chat and see if your pets would do well with my schedule! If I am caring for your pet in your home, I will follow the instructions you have left for me. I am always careful about human food and ensure it is not out where they can reach or climb, as human food can be dangerous for many reasons. On walks, I always avoid interaction with humans/other pets to prevent anything unwanted from happening. Your pet's safety and the safety of others is always number one. I recently found out I am allergic to cats and dogs, but that will never keep me away from them! So, I kindly ask you to instruct me where any cleaning products/vacuums are so I can keep up with the pet hair during the stay. Due to the many different dogs I am around now and how my allergies get, the bed is the only place I would prefer them not to stay with me.

Las Vegas do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while you're at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Las Vegas s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itter's home and rest easy knowing they'll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
